The Role:
This exciting role involves supporting the Private Patients Manager in driving growth and increased referrals across all payor channels into the hospital and Ramsay Health Care as a whole, by developing and delivering excellent stakeholder engagement and communications.
The Business Relations Manager role is based primarily at the hospital with accountability for increasing and delivering targeted referrals and revenues by building strong links and effective stakeholder relationships across the referring healthcare community.
You will work within a defined territory with the intent of increasing Ramsay's market share, and brand awareness and will require visits to agreed target groups as and when business needs arise.
The successful candidate will organise and facilitate educational events and develop referral opportunities between consultants, GPs and other external stakeholders through various high quality communication methods, both virtually and face to face. You will be responsible for assisting with developing an engagement strategy and delivering promotional activity.
The role will be supported by using analytics and data insight to ensure optimal use of time and resource for both new and existing referrers in order to develop your portfolio, and to identify opportunities for business development in line with the hospital's strategic business plan and targets.
Where you'll be based:
Rivers Hospital is based on the Herts & Essex border and are easily accessible from London and the Home Counties. Rivers hospital opened in 1992 and is equipped with the latest medical facilities for diagnosis and treatment and has exceptional high-quality clinical standards.
